首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在angular js中使用带有标题的多选下拉菜单

在AngularJS中使用带有标题的多选下拉菜单,可以通过以下步骤实现:

  1. 首先,确保你已经引入了AngularJS库文件,并在HTML页面中添加了ng-app指令,以启用AngularJS应用。
  2. 在HTML页面中,创建一个包含标题和多选下拉菜单的容器元素,例如一个div元素。
代码语言:txt
复制
<div ng-app="myApp" ng-controller="myCtrl">
  <h3>多选下拉菜单</h3>
  <select multiple ng-model="selectedItems">
    <option ng-repeat="item in items" value="{{item}}">{{item}}</option>
  </select>
</div>
  1. 在AngularJS应用的JavaScript代码中,定义一个控制器(controller)并将其与HTML页面中的容器元素关联起来。
代码语言:txt
复制
var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ope) {
  $scope.items = ['选项1', '选项2', '选项3', '选项4']; // 定义下拉菜单的选项
  $scope.selectedItems = []; // 初始化选中的选项

  // 监听选中的选项变化
  $scope.$watch('selectedItems', function(newVal, oldVal) {
    console.log('选中的选项:', newVal);
  }, true);
});
  1. 在上述代码中,我们使用ng-model指令将选中的选项与$scope.selectedItems绑定,以便在控制器中获取选中的选项。
  2. 最后,你可以根据需要自定义样式和功能,例如添加按钮来触发特定操作,或者使用ng-change指令来监听选项的变化。

这样,你就可以在AngularJS中使用带有标题的多选下拉菜单了。根据具体的业务需求,你可以进一步扩展和定制这个下拉菜单,例如从后端获取选项数据、添加搜索功能等。

腾讯云相关产品和产品介绍链接地址:

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券